NASA warns of a 100ft asteroid to pass 'extremely close' to Earth at 47, 921 kmph

IndiaTimes Saturday, 13 July 2024 ()
NASA has warned about a 100-foot asteroid, 2024 NB2, set to pass extremely close to Earth on July 13, 2024, at a speed of 47,921 km/h. Discovered by the Catalina Sky Survey, it will come within 3,850,000 kilometers of Earth. Monitored by NASA’s Jet Propulsion Laboratory and the Goldstone Solar System Radar, this event underscores the importance of tracking near-Earth objects to understand their behavior and improve planetary defense strategies.
